 * the city of.
   This city was situated somewhere in the vicinity, west of the
   lake Asphaltites; and supposed by some to be the same as Zoar.

 * En-gedi.
   En-gedi, or Hazazon-Tamar, was situated, according to
   Eusebius, in the desert west of the Dead Sea.  Josephus says
   it was 300; stadia from Jerusalem, and not far from the lake
   Asphaltites; and consequently it could not have been far from
   Jericho and the mouth of the Jordan.  It was celebrated for
   the abundance of its palm-trees.
